C. F. Powell Quote

Coming out of space and incident on the high atmosphere, there is a thin rain of charged particles known as the primary cosmic radiation.


Nobel Lectures, Physics 1942-1962 - Nobel lecture for award received in 1950 - The Cosmic Radiation (p. 144), Elsevier Publishing Company. Amsterdam, Netherlands. 1964
